Louis XV Period Italian Mirror

An Italian mirror from the Louis XV period.
In the Rocaille style, this gilded wood mirror features a pediment framing a painting of a bucolic subject. The frame has curved lines at the top and is molded with heart-shaped stripes on the inside. The whole is
composed of cockerel crests, C-shaped motifs, florets, foliage and shells. Openwork motif in the center of the lower crosspiece. The gilding is original, weathered and nicely crackled on the jambs (visible by zooming in on the photos lit with artificial light), the red plate is visible. Two missing motifs at the end. Nice original mercury tint, blackened parts. The worn, slightly restored pediment painting reveals a twilight country scene in a wooded landscape, house, paths and figures.
